Putting together my Haradrim Raiders, I had an extra banner.

Image

Remembering I had a temple model I had bought at a museum store in South Korea, I put the banner on top.

Image

Image

The corner "posts" are beads. I had originally thought of using deer point beads but they were too expensive. At the bead store I found these plastic shark(?) teeth that would work well as Mumak tusks.

Image

Relatively easy to fill in the bead holes and drill out the plaster to mount them on the corners.

While the beads were relatively cheap at 50 cents each I have since looked online and can find them in bulk at much cheaper. Have to think how to use more of them as I paint my Harad army.

Still playing on how big to build the platform and walls for the temple, but as long as I am casting plaster for the Gondor Outpost, what is a few more castings.

Messed around with some more antlers this weekend while watching american football.

Tried out my painting scheme where I wanted to use Vallejo Iraqi Sand as my base so I painted a small board with it and took it to a local hardware store where they matched the color and made me a quart (946ml) of it.

Used Agrax Earthshade as a wash, think I need to thin it down some, came out a little darker than I think I want. Need to use my finer pumice around the tusks also, too coarse looking I think.

Not sure if this is a standalone piece or a stairway up into the temple base.

I like the look of this, but might tear off the tusks and try again.

Image

Image

Image

Image

Author:  Mapper [ Sat Dec 01, 2018 6:08 pm ]
Post subject:  Re: Yet more Harad stuff

Kicked myself, after using a wash you should always drybrush after.

Drybrushed with Iraqi Sand and lightened it up and brought out the detail more. Still should have used finer pumice though.
